刑法学总论 Criminal Law (Coursera) Coursera
Peking University

刑法学总论 Criminal Law (Coursera)

This introductory course to Criminal Law offers a concise yet thorough overview of the key concepts, theories, and methods in contemporary criminal law studies. Learn about the basic notions of criminal law and criminal science, the justification for punishment, the principle of legality in penal codes, legal interpretation, the scope of application of criminal law, the definitions of crime and its elements, the exclusion of crimes, the concept of incomplete crimes, joint liability, the nature and system of penalties, sentencing procedures, cumulative sentences, probation, commutation, and parole. The course combines theoretical explanations with case analyses to deepen understanding on relevant issues.
